  • The Optimum Temperature For Legionella Growth

    Legionella is a type of bacteria that can cause Legionnaires’ disease, a severe form of pneumonia. This bacterium is commonly found in natural and artificial water sources, such as lakes, rivers, and plumbing systems. Legionella is known to thrive in temperatures between 77°F and 108°F, with the optimum temperature for growth being around 95°F. Understanding the optimum temperature for legionella growth is crucial in preventing outbreaks of Legionnaires’ disease.

    Legionella bacteria are known to multiply at a rapid rate in warm water environments. When water temperatures are between 77°F and 108°F, Legionella can proliferate within plumbing systems, cooling towers, hot tubs, and other water sources. The bacteria thrive in environments where there is stagnant water or biofilm, making it easier for Legionella to colonize and spread.

    The optimum temperature for legionella growth is around 95°F, which falls within the range of temperatures commonly found in hot water systems and cooling towers. At this temperature, Legionella bacteria can double in numbers every 2 to 4 hours, leading to a rapid increase in bacterial load within the water source. This poses a significant risk to those who come into contact with contaminated water, as inhalation of Legionella-containing aerosols can lead to infection.

    In addition to temperature, other factors can also influence the growth of Legionella bacteria. pH levels, nutrients, and the presence of biofilm can all play a role in creating an environment conducive to Legionella growth. However, temperature remains a key factor in determining the rate at which Legionella can multiply and spread within a water source.

  • Understanding The Efficiency Of Plate And Heat Exchangers

    plate and heat exchangers are crucial components in various industrial processes, helping to efficiently transfer heat from one fluid to another. These heat exchangers are widely used in industries such as HVAC, chemical processing, power generation, and food and beverage production. Understanding how plate and heat exchangers work and their benefits can help businesses improve their processes and save on energy costs.

    plate and heat exchangers consist of a series of plates that are stacked together with small gaps in between them. These plates are typically made from materials such as stainless steel, titanium, or nickel alloys, which are known for their excellent thermal conductivity and corrosion resistance. The plates are arranged in such a way that they create a series of channels for the two fluids to flow through. One fluid flows through the channels on one side of the plates while the other fluid flows through the channels on the other side. As the fluids pass through the channels, heat is transferred from one fluid to the other through the thin metal plates, which act as conduits for heat exchange.

    One of the key advantages of plate and heat exchangers is their compact design, which allows for a high surface area for heat transfer in a relatively small footprint. This compact design results in greater efficiency and lower energy consumption compared to traditional shell and tube heat exchangers. Because of their efficiency, plate and heat exchangers are often used in applications where space is limited or where a high heat transfer coefficient is required. This makes them ideal for use in industries such as automotive, HVAC, and chemical processing.

    Another benefit of plate and heat exchangers is their modularity and flexibility. The plates in a plate and heat exchanger can be easily removed and replaced, allowing for easy maintenance and repair. Additionally, the number of plates can be adjusted to accommodate changes in flow rates and temperature requirements, making plate and heat exchangers highly customizable for a wide range of applications. This flexibility makes plate and heat exchangers a cost-effective solution for businesses that need to adapt to changing process conditions.

    plate and heat exchangers are also known for their high heat transfer efficiency. The design of the plates creates turbulent flow patterns, which maximize the contact between the fluids and the plate surfaces. This increased contact area results in a more efficient heat transfer process and allows for greater heat recovery. As a result, plate and heat exchangers can help businesses save on energy costs and reduce their carbon footprint.

  • The Importance Of Copper Etchant In Printed Circuit Board Manufacturing

    copper etchant is a critical component in the production of printed circuit boards (PCBs). PCBs are essentially the building blocks of many electronic devices, providing a platform for the components to be mounted and interconnected. copper etchant is used in the process of removing unwanted copper from the surface of the PCB to create the circuitry needed for the device to function properly.

    In the world of electronics manufacturing, precision is key. Even the smallest error in the PCB manufacturing process can lead to malfunctioning devices. copper etchant plays a vital role in ensuring the accuracy and reliability of the PCB. By selectively removing copper from the surface of the board, the etchant helps to create the intricate pathways that make up the electrical connections on the PCB.

    The process of etching copper involves submerging the PCB in a solution that contains a specific combination of chemicals. These chemicals work together to dissolve the unwanted copper while leaving the rest of the board unaffected. The selective nature of the etchant ensures that only the necessary copper is removed, allowing for precise control over the circuit design.

    One of the most common types of copper etchant used in PCB manufacturing is ferric chloride. Ferric chloride is a highly effective etchant that is widely used in the industry due to its ability to quickly and accurately remove copper from the board. It is also relatively safe to handle, making it a popular choice among manufacturers.

    Another commonly used copper etchant is ammonium persulfate. This type of etchant is preferred by some manufacturers due to its lower environmental impact compared to ferric chloride. Ammonium persulfate is also relatively safe to use and provides excellent etching results when properly controlled.

    The choice of copper etchant depends on various factors, including the complexity of the circuit design, the thickness of the copper layer, and the desired etching speed. Manufacturers must carefully consider these factors when selecting an etchant to ensure that the finished PCB meets the required specifications.

    The etching process itself requires careful monitoring to ensure that the copper is removed evenly and efficiently. Over-etching can weaken the circuitry and lead to electrical issues, while under-etching can result in short circuits and other problems. Proper control of the etching process is essential to producing high-quality PCBs that perform reliably.
